Analysis

The most recent figure for inbound internationally mobile students from south and west asia in SDG: Sub-saharan Africa is 1,128, measured in 2011. That is the highest value across all 6 years on record.

Compared with earlier readings it is up 19.6% on the previous year and up 241.9% over ten years.

Over the whole period, inbound internationally mobile students from south and west asia in SDG: Sub-saharan Africa peaked at 1,128 in 2011 and was at its lowest, 330, in 1998.

SDG: Sub-saharan Africa ranks 82nd of 113 groups on this measure, in the middle of the range.
